Vortices as Instantons in Noncommutative Discrete Space: Use of $Z_{2}$ Coordinates

Abstract

We show that vortices of Yang-Mills-Higgs model in R2R^{2} space can be regarded as instantons of Yang-Mills model in R2×Z2R^{2}\times Z_{2} space. For this, we construct the noncommutative Z2Z_{2} space by explicitly fixing the Z2Z_{2} coordinates and then show, by using the Z2Z_{2} coordinates, that BPS equation for the vortices can be considered as a self-dual equation. We also propose the possibility to rewrite the BPS equations for vortices as ADHM equations through the use of self-dual equation.
